The Role of a Car Locksmith
A car locksmith focuses on offering security solutions for vehicles, including key replacement, lock setup, and emergency lockout support. Unlike a general locksmith who deals with a variety of locks, an automotive locksmith focuses exclusively on the detailed systems discovered in cars and trucks, trucks, and other cars. These professionals are geared up with the current tools and technology to manage a large range of automotive security needs.
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Replacement and Duplication
Lost or Stolen Keys: If you've lost your keys or they have actually been stolen, a car locksmith can offer a new set. They utilize customized devices to develop precise duplicates of your original keys.Broken Keys: Sometimes, keys break inside the lock, making it difficult to eliminate them. An expert locksmith can extract the broken key and produce a new one.
Keyless Entry and Ignition Systems
Programing Key Fobs: Modern automobiles often come with keyless entry systems. A car locksmith can program and replace key fobs, ensuring that your vehicle's electronic parts operate effortlessly.Ignition Interlock Devices: For chauffeurs with a history of DUI, ignition interlock devices are sometimes mandated by law. A car locksmith can install and preserve these devices.
Lock Installation and Repair
New Locks: If your vehicle's locks are damaged or malfunctioning, a car locksmith can set up brand-new ones.Lock Repair: Rather than changing locks, a locksmith can typically repair them, saving you money and time.
Emergency Situation Lockout Assistance
24/7 Service: Being locked out of your car can occur at any time. Many car locksmith professionals use 24/7 emergency situation services to help you return on the road rapidly.Expert Tools: They use specialized tools to unlock your vehicle without triggering damage, which is particularly important for more recent models with complicated security systems.
High-Security Locks and Keys
Transponder Keys: These keys contain a chip that interacts with the car's computer system. A car locksmith can program and replace these keys.Laser-Cut Keys: Some high-end vehicles utilize laser-cut keys for improved security. Q: How do I know if a car locksmith is legitimate?
A: A genuine car locksmith will be certified, bonded, and insured. They must likewise have the ability to supply evidence of ownership before performing any services. Furthermore, check for positive reviews and a good track record in the community.
Q: Can a car locksmith make a key for a vehicle without the initial?
A: Yes, a professional car locksmith can create a brand-new key even if you do not have the original. Nevertheless, they will require the vehicle's make, design, and sometimes the VIN to make sure the key is correct.
Q: How long does it take to replace a car key?
A: The time it takes to replace a car key can vary depending upon the intricacy of the lock and the kind of key. Simple key duplications can take simply a couple of minutes, while more complex tasks like programming transponder keys might take an hour or more.
Q: Will a car locksmith damage my vehicle when unlocking it?
A: An expert car locksmith will use non-invasive techniques to open your vehicle, reducing the risk of damage. However, if a key is stuck in the lock, some small damage may be inevitable.
Q: Can a car locksmith bypass the ignition system?
A: While a competent car key and locksmith locksmith can bypass the ignition system to open your car, they will refrain from doing so unless you can prove ownership of the vehicle. Bypassing the ignition system without appropriate authorization is prohibited.
